Best Casino Payment Methods in Australia 2026

Top Casino Payment Methods

Available payment options differ in deposit speed, withdrawal conditions, fees, and verification requirements. Players should assess the complete movement of their money because a method offering instant deposits may not support payouts. The following options regularly appear at platforms serving Australian users. All time frames are estimates and depend on the operator, financial provider, currency, and account status.

Bank Transfer

Bank transfer to a secure casino account

A direct bank transfer suits users who prefer a clear banking record and comparatively high limits. Faster domestic payments may arrive sooner than standard or international transactions.

  • Deposits take from several minutes to three business days.
  • Payouts usually require between one and five business days.
  • Bank charges and currency conversion costs may apply.
  • Weekends and public holidays can extend the processing period.

Visa and Mastercard

Secure Visa and Mastercard casino payments

Cards provide a familiar payment form and allow players to fund an account quickly. Returning money to the original card is not always supported, so available payout options should be reviewed before payment.

  • The gaming balance usually updates immediately after confirmation.
  • A card payout may take between two and five business days.
  • The issuer, platform, or exchange service may charge a fee.
  • Some banks decline transactions associated with gambling services.

E-Wallets

Mobile e-wallet with coins for payments at best aucasinos

Digital wallets separate gaming transactions from the main bank account and often speed up approved payouts. PayPal rarely appears at offshore platforms because gambling-related transactions require prior approval under its Acceptable Use Policy.

  • Money is normally credited to the gaming balance immediately.
  • An approved payout may arrive within several minutes or take up to 48 hours.
  • Wallet charges and foreign exchange costs may apply.
  • The available services depend on the platform and region.

PayID

Secure PayID casino payment via verified mobile transfer

This Australian payment address connects a mobile number, email address, ABN, or organisation identifier to a bank account. Users do not need to enter a BSB and account number for every transaction.

  • Transfers are normally completed in under one minute.
  • A payout may arrive on the same day if the operator supports outgoing payments.
  • The sending bank generally does not charge a separate fee.
  • A financial institution may hold unusual activity for review.

Cryptocurrency

Cryptocurrency casino payment with Bitcoin and a digital wallet at best aucasinos

Digital assets allow international transfers without relying on card networks. Players who deposit and withdraw with crypto must choose matching assets and blockchain networks.

  • Funding normally takes between 5 and 60 minutes.
  • Receipt after approval may require 10 minutes to several hours.
  • Total costs include network charges and exchange expenses.
  • An incorrect address or network selection may cause an irreversible loss of funds.

Paysafecard

Prepaid Paysafecard payment with voucher and security shield

A prepaid voucher lets users add money without giving bank or card details to the gaming platform. The Australian version uses a 16-digit code and is primarily intended for account funding.

  • Funds usually appear immediately after the code is activated.
  • Withdrawals to the original voucher are generally unavailable.
  • Purchase, conversion, or balance maintenance charges may apply.
  • The current limit for one transaction is up to A$200, subject to the provider’s conditions.

Payment Experience

The complete process includes account funding, ownership checks, payout approval, and final receipt of the money. Players should establish whether one service can be used to deposit and withdraw, as cards and prepaid products sometimes work in only one direction. Reviewing both stages reduces the likelihood of needing an unfamiliar alternative later.

Deposit Options

Funding an account usually involves the following steps:

  1. Open the cashier and enter the deposit section.
  2. Select an available option and review its minimum amount, upper limit, accepted currency, and stated fee.
  3. Enter the required amount and payment details.
  4. Confirm the request through the bank, wallet, card network, voucher system, or blockchain.
  5. Check that the gaming balance has changed before placing a wager.

The account holder’s name should match the information registered to the funding source when ownership checks apply. Using another person’s card, wallet, or bank account may result in rejection and a request for extra documents. Anyone claiming a promotion should also confirm that the chosen option meets its conditions before authorising the transfer.

Withdrawal Process

Receiving money normally involves more detailed checks than adding it:

  1. Complete identity verification and provide proof of payment ownership when requested.
  2. Open the withdrawal section and select an available destination.
  3. Enter an amount within the displayed minimum and maximum thresholds.
  4. Check the bank details, wallet account, or digital asset address.
  5. Submit the request and wait for internal review before external payment processing begins.

The first payout may take longer if the documents have not been reviewed previously. Mismatched details, incomplete wagering conditions, fraud screening, weekends, and public holidays can also extend the waiting period. Reusing the original eligible option may simplify source-of-funds checks, although the platform can assign another method when the instrument used for funding cannot receive incoming payments.

FAQ

E-wallets and cryptocurrency often provide the shortest payout times after approval. PayID may also work quickly when the platform supports outgoing payments through compatible banking infrastructure. Internal review and verification can still add several hours or days.

PayID is available at some platforms serving Australian users, but it is not offered everywhere. Its availability should be confirmed directly in the cashier. Before approving a transfer, users should check the displayed recipient name and avoid sending money through unverified instructions.

Costs depend on the operator, provider, currency, and transaction type. They may include a fixed cashier fee, a percentage-based wallet charge, banking expenses, a blockchain network fee, or an exchange-rate mark-up. The final amount should be reviewed before confirmation.

Card transactions may be protected by encryption, issuer monitoring, and 3D Secure authentication. Safety also depends on the platform and the user’s bank. Debit cards are generally more relevant because Australian-regulated online wagering services cannot accept credit cards under rules in effect since 11 June 2024.

Some offshore platforms accept Bitcoin, Ethereum, stablecoins, and other digital assets. The availability of this option does not confirm Australian authorisation. Users should check the network, address, required confirmations, exchange costs, and withdrawal rules before transferring funds.

A faster domestic transfer may arrive within several minutes, while a standard or international transaction can require one to three business days. Approved payouts often take between one and five business days, depending on intermediary banks, weekends, and compliance checks.

Most platforms set minimum and maximum payout amounts. The thresholds may depend on the selected option, account level, currency, and verification status. Daily, weekly, or monthly restrictions may also apply, so the cashier terms should be reviewed before making a deposit.

Paysafecard reduces the payment details shared when funding an account, while cryptocurrency uses wallet addresses instead of card numbers. Neither option provides complete anonymity. Account verification, blockchain records, exchange checks, and source-of-funds requirements may still connect a transaction to its owner.
